它保存数据时所消耗的内存空间较多
来自:11 | “万金油”的String,为什么不好用了?
29 人划过
这跟 Redis 的持久化机制有关系。在使用 RDB 进行持久化时,Redis 会 fork 子进程来完成,fork 操作的用时和 Redis 的数据量是正相关的,而 fork 在执行时会阻塞主线程。数据量越大,fork 操作造成的主线程阻塞的时间越长。所以,在使用 RDB 对 25GB 的数据进行持久化时,数据量较大,后台运行的子进程在 fork 创建时阻塞了主线程,于是就导致 Redis 响应变慢了。
来自:09 | 切片集群:数据增多了,是该加内存还是加实例?
26 人划过
如果在 down-after-milliseconds 毫秒内,主从节点都没有通过网络联系上,我们就可以认为主从节点断连了。如果发生断连的次数超过了 10 次,就说明这个从库的网络状况不好,不适合作为新主库。
来自:07 | 哨兵机制:主库挂了,如何不间断服务?
23 人划过
等到这些增改的数据要被从缓存中淘汰出来时,缓存将它们写回后端数据库
来自:23 | 旁路缓存:Redis是如何工作的?
19 人划过
如果你观察到的 Redis 运行时延迟是其基线性能的 2 倍及以上,就可以认定 Redis 变慢了
来自:18 | 波动的响应延迟:如何应对变慢的Redis?(上)
14 人划过
这里就涉及到了 Redis 用来实现简单的事务的 MULTI 和 EXEC 命令。当多个命令及其参数本身无误时,MULTI 和 EXEC 命令可以保证执行这些命令时的原子性。
来自:14 | 如何在Redis中保存时间序列数据?
13 人划过
这对括号会把 key 的一部分括起来,客户端在计算 key 的 CRC16 值时,只对 Hash Tag 花括号中的 key 内容进行计算
来自:37 | 数据分布优化:如何应对数据倾斜?
10 人划过
Redis Cluster 的实例启动后,默认会每秒从本地的实例列表中随机选出 5 个实例,再从这 5 个实例中找出一个最久没有通信的实例,把 PING 消息发送给该实例
来自:38 | 通信开销:限制Redis Cluster规模的关键因素
8 人划过
Redis 的主从集群可以提升数据可靠性,主节点在和从节点进行数据同步时,会使用两个缓冲区:复制缓冲区和复制积压缓冲区,这两个缓冲区的作用各是什么?会对 Redis 主从同步产生什么影响吗?
来自:期中测试题 | 一套习题,测出你的掌握程度
7 人划过
RESP 3 协议增加了对多种数据类型的支持,包括空值、浮点数、布尔值、有序的字典集合、无序的集合等
来自:加餐(四) | Redis客户端如何与服务器端交换命令和数据?
3 人划过
*精彩内容为该课程各文章中划线次数最多的内容
编辑推荐
讲师的其他课程
包含这门课的学习路径
Java工程师
29门课程 154.7w人学习
Go工程师
16门课程 89.9w人学习
分布式工程师
8门课程 48.8w人学习
看过的人还看了